Interesting! I've never looked closely at the oil circuit and just took a look at FSM 18-005 Oil circuit, oil pressure, pressure relief valve and oil filter. Pretty sophiscated oil filter!

From the diagram and description, it does appear that if the oil cooler is blocked or bypassed (note the oil cooler is essentially blocked by the thermostat with a cold engine), the engine will still get filtered oil via the main flow filter component (24a), which is separated by a seal to the bypass filter component (24).

Up until now, I didn't know there are 2 separate filter components in the filter element. I'm gonna have to cut one open to have a closer look and see how it is constructed.
